What are the most common Mazda repair issues for drivers in the Foosland, Illinois area?

In our climate, Mazda models often need attention for suspension components due to local rural road conditions, and for battery/charging system checks, especially before winter. Issues with the infotainment system or minor electrical gremlins are also frequent service items we see at local shops.

Are Mazda repair costs higher in Foosland compared to taking my car to a dealership in Champaign?

Typically, independent repair shops in the Foosland area offer significantly lower labor rates than dealerships in Champaign, saving you money. However, for very complex computer or warranty-related issues, the dealership's specialized factory tools and training may sometimes be necessary.

When should I seek local service for my Mazda's check engine light instead of ignoring it?

You should seek service immediately if the light is flashing, or if you notice any performance loss, strange noises, or overheating. For a steady light, schedule a diagnostic scan promptly at a local shop to prevent a minor issue from becoming a major, costly repair, especially before long drives on Route 47.

What local factors in the Foosland area should influence my Mazda's maintenance schedule?

The seasonal extremes and gravel/dusty rural roads mean you should adhere strictly to oil change intervals and pay extra attention to air filters and cabin filters. More frequent undercarriage washes in winter to combat road salt and pre-winter battery checks are highly recommended for reliable operation.
